Conceptual Understanding: The Building Blocks

Picture math concepts as Lego blocks. To score high in PSLE, your child needs a solid foundation. Here's how you can measure their understanding:

  • Pre- and Post-Tests: Compare initial and final scores on specific topics to see how far they've come.
  • Past Papers: Track their improvement over time using school and past-year PSLE papers.
  • Quizzes and Worksheets: Regular, targeted quizzes help identify and address knowledge gaps.

Exam Strategies: The Race Day Plan

Think of exam strategies as a race day plan. Here's how to monitor your child's progress:

  • Time Management: Track their speed and accuracy using timed practice.
  • Answering Techniques: Observe their ability to answer questions using keywords, diagrams, or formulas.
  • Mock Exams: Regular mocks help replicate exam conditions and identify areas for improvement.

In Singaporean, the education system concludes primary schooling with a national examination which evaluates students' academic achievements and determines their secondary school pathways. Such assessment occurs on a yearly basis among pupils in their final year of elementary schooling, highlighting key subjects for assessing overall proficiency. The PSLE functions as a benchmark in determining entry to suitable secondary programs according to results. It encompasses areas like English Language, Mathematics, Science, and Mother Tongue Languages, with formats refreshed occasionally to reflect educational standards. Evaluation is based on performance levels spanning 1 through 8, such that the aggregate PSLE mark represents the total from each subject's points, impacting future academic opportunities..
